CSS3单元格法是一个经久不衰的技术,它可以很好地完成页面布局。在当今的Web开发中,CSS3仍然是关键的技术,因为网页需要美观的外观和良好的用户体验。在这篇文章中,我们将解释CSS3单元格法是什么,...
CSS3单元格法是一个经久不衰的技术,它可以很好地完成页面布局。在当今的Web开发中,CSS3仍然是关键的技术,因为网页需要美观的外观和良好的用户体验。在这篇文章中,我们将解释CSS3单元格法是什么,以及它为什么能够经久不衰。
CSS3单元格法是一种灵活的网页布局方法,因为它允许我们使用行和列来布局页面。这种技术没有固定的容器大小,而是根据内容和可用空间来自动调整容器大小。使用CSS3单元格法,我们可以创建自适应或响应式网页,它们可以适应不同的屏幕大小和分辨率。
.container {
display: grid;
grid-template-columns: repeat(3, 1fr);
grid-gap: 10px;
}
.item {
grid-column: 1 / span 3;
} 在这个例子中,我们将一个容器分成三列,并为它们设置等分的宽度(1fr是1个单位的剩余空间,所以3个1fr将容器分成三个等宽的列)。我们还为单元格之间设置了10像素的间隔。对于其中一个单元格,我们使用grid-column属性将它跨越三个列,从第一列开始。
CSS3单元格法是最新版的CSS规范,它包含许多实用功能,如控制行和列的大小,对齐单元格,跨越多个单元格,设置单元格间的间距,以及响应式布局。这些功能使得CSS3单元格法成为一种非常强大的布局工具。
此外,CSS3单元格法还有很好的浏览器支持。目前,几乎所有的现代浏览器都支持CSS3单元格法,包括Chrome、Firefox、Safari、Edge和Opera。这意味着我们可以放心地在我们的网页中使用CSS3单元格法,而不必担心兼容性问题。
最后,CSS3单元格法是一个易于学习和使用的技术。即使您是一个新手,您也可以通过一些简单的CSS样式就能实现自适应或响应式布局。通过展示一些例子,您可以快速地理解如何使用CSS3单元格法构建网页布局。
总之,CSS3单元格法是一个非常强大而且经久不衰的技术,它具有灵活性、强大的功能和广泛的浏览器支持。它可以帮助我们创建美观而且适配不同屏幕和分辨率的网页布局。因此,我们应该掌握CSS3单元格法,并在我们的网页中广泛使用它。